Finance Review Summary — Retail Pilot, Plumwick Foods

Quick recap for the finance team: the pilot with the Marlow & Tate grocery chain ran eight weeks across six stores. Sell-through beat forecast by about 9%, though promo funding ate more margin than we'd like. Logistics costs were fine once the Derrow depot sorted its scheduling. Overall, cautiously positive numbers. The confidential note below covers where we plan to take this.

internal memo for yahag-tahog: The pricing group signed off on a budget of $152.8 million for Project Soriel.

## Alert: StatRelay Sidecar Flush Lag

This alert fires when the StatRelay metrics-aggregation sidecar falls more than 120 seconds behind on flushing buffered samples to the Coalmine backend. Plugin-emitted counters are buffered in-process, so sustained lag usually means a plugin is emitting unbounded label cardinality or blocking the flush thread. Check your plugin's metric registration against the published cardinality limits before escalating. If the lag persists after your plugin is ruled out, contact the telemetry team.

escalation mailbox, bagug-fahof: novdor.wendor.jormir@norvalabs.example

## 2.8.1 — Key rotation

Rotated the signing key for Fieldnote Offline sync bundles after the quarterly audit flagged the old key as past its lifetime. Offline mode on survey devices will reject bundles signed with the retired key starting next Monday. No action needed for already-cached tiles. If a device fails verification, re-push the manifest. The new key is as follows.

deploy key for kajof-fajop: bky6_gDHw9Q